How much do online inbound call center j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for online inbound call center in Georgetown, KY is $15.65,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.09 and $16.49 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an online inbound call center?

An Online Inbound Call Center job involves handling incoming customer calls, usually from a remote or virtual location. Agents assist with inquiries, troubleshoot issues, process orders, or provide support based on the company's services. Unlike outbound call centers, inbound agents do not make sales calls but instead focus on responding to customer needs. Strong communication skills, problem-solving abilities, and knowledge of company policies are essential for success in this role. Many online call center positions allow employees to work from home using internet-based phone systems.

What does an online inbound call center do?

An Online Inbound Call Center representative is primarily responsible for answering incoming calls, addressing customer questions or concerns, and providing accurate information or solutions based on company policies. You may also be expected to log interactions in the company’s CRM system, escalate complex issues to supervisors or specialized teams, and follow up with customers as needed. Additionally, maintaining a courteous and professional demeanor, meeting daily performance metrics, and adapting to different customer personalities are key parts of the job. Working in this role often involves collaborating with team members, participating in training sessions, and staying updated on new products or procedures to provide the best service possible.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the online inbound call center position?

To excel in an Online Inbound Call Center role, candidates typically need strong verbal communication, active listening, problem-solving abilities,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software, call routing systems, and basic troubleshooting tools is usually required. Exceptional patience, empathy, and multitasking skills help individuals stand out in handling customer inquiries and resolving issues efficiently. These capabilities are crucial for ensuring customer satisfaction, maintaining call quality standards, and supporting high-volume customer service operations.

Job description

WHITAKER BANK

CALL CENTER POSITION DESCRIPTION

 SUMMARY


The position of a Call Center Representative is responsible for answering calls from customers answering questions or addressing concerns they may have related to their accounts. They may refer customers to appropriate staff for specific services. The position of a Call Center Representative also is required to be fully knowledgeable and skilled in the areas of customer service, checking and savings accounts, debit card transactions and online banking.


Assures compliance with all Bank policies and procedures, as well as, all applicable state and federal banking regulations.


ESSENTIAL DUTIES


  1. Answer calls promptly as they come in, and answer calls in the queue.
  1. Assists consumer and business customers in their questions about accounts, products and financial services available from the Bank; ensures cross-sell opportunities are presented by applying professional sales techniques.
  1. Investigates and corrects errors; and resolves problems or other issues if the queue is not overloaded. Otherwise transfer the call to the correct personnel.
  1. Demonstrates knowledge of and adherence to EEO policy; shows respect and sensitivity for cultural differences; educates others on the value of diversity; promotes working environment free of harassment of any type; builds a diverse workforce and supports affirmative action. 
  1. You are to conduct yourself professionally and as a bank representative while at work and in public.
  1. Follows policies and procedures; completes administrative tasks correctly and on time; supports the Bank’s goals and values; benefits the bank through outside activities.
  1. Performs the position safely, without endangering the health or safety to themselves or others and will be expected to report potentially unsafe conditions. The employee shall comply with occupational safety and health standards and all rules, regulations and orders issued pursuant to the OSHA Act of 1970, which are applicable to one’s own actions and conduct.


SECONDARY DUTIES


The position of a Call Center Representative performs duties specific to the position and other functions as assigned. 

 S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ITY


The position of a Call Center Representative is not responsible for the supervision of any employee(s), however the incumbent required to assist in the cross-training of less experienced branch staff members.


ENVIRONMENT AND PHYSICAL ACTIVITY


The incumbent is in a confined office-type setting in which he or she will be sitting most of the work day. 


The incumbent in the course of performing this position spends time writing, typing, speaking, listening, lifting (up to 20 pounds), driving, carrying, seeing (such as close, color and peripheral vision, depth perception and adjusted focus), sitting, pulling, walking, standing, squatting, kneeling and reaching.


The incumbent for this position may operate any or all of the following: telephone, cellular telephone, copy and fax machines, adding machine (calculator), check protector, scanner and image systems, money counter, typewriter, computer terminal, laptop computer, personal computer and related printers, or other equipment as directed.


The work environment characteristics described here are representative of those an employee encounters while performing the essential functions of this job. 


The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job.


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ions. 

MENTAL DEMANDS


The incumbent in this position must be able to accommodate to reading documents or instruments, detailed work, problem solving, customer contact, reasoning, math, language, presentations, verbal and written communication, analytical reasoning, stress, multiple concurrent tasks and constant interruptions.


M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S


These specifications are general guidelines based on the minimum experience normally considered essential to the satisfactory performance of this position.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ill and/or ability required to perform the position in a satisfactory manner. Individual abilities may result in some deviation from these guidelines.


  • High school diploma or general education degree (GED); or 1 year of related experience and/or training; or the equivalent combination of education and experience. Work related experience should consist of a financial institution operations, sales or customer service background. Educational experience, through in-house training sessions, formal school or financial industry related curriculum, should be business or financial industry related.
  • Intermediate experience, knowledge and training in branch operation activities, terminology and products and services relating to retail and commercial account customers.
  • Basic knowledge of related state and federal banking compliance regulations, and other Bank operational policies.
  • Intermediate skills in computer terminal and personal computer operation; mainframe computer system; and word processing, spreadsheet and account opening software programs.
  • Intermediate typing skills to meet production needs of the position.
  • Basic knowledge of general office practices.
  • Basic math skills; calculate interest and balance accounts; add, subtract, multiply and divide in all units of measure, using whole numbers, common fractions and decimals; locate routine mathematical errors; count currency, coin and negotiable instruments in a timely manner.
  • Effective oral, written and interpersonal communication skills with the ability to apply common sense to carry out instructions, interpret documents, understand procedures, write reports and correspondence, and speak clearly to customers and employees.
  • Ability to deal with difficult problems involving multiple facets and variables in non-standardized situations.
  • Effective organizational and time management skills.
  • Ability to work with general supervision while performing duties.
  • Current driver’s license and a vehicle with appropriate insurance coverage if required to drive in the course of performing assigned duties and responsibilities.
